Mesquite, TX – April 10, 2017 – The City of Mesquite has announced a new public education campaign called Drive Like Your Family Lives Here to address traffic safety issues in its community. For details on the campaign, visit www.DriveLikeYourFamilyLivesHere.org.
Mesquite City Manager Cliff Keheley said, “Improving traffic safety is about changing behaviors. Our citizens have raised their concerns about speeding in our neighborhoods, the safety of students who walk to our schools and other traffic safety issues. The importance of traffic safety greatly affects the entire community. This public education campaign will be our ongoing effort to make Mesquite safer for families and kids.”
The Drive Like Your Family Lives Here campaign will be directed towards citizens, visitors and the business community. The City will use a variety of bilingual communications that will include outdoor signage, social media, videos and other methods to remind the community about the importance of traffic safety. There will also be special events and activities planned throughout the year to engage the public’s help with the campaign.
